For the background I dry embossed the Craft-A-Round mini slimline die onto the background (after I had ink blended with Distress Oxide ink). It makes such a pretty soft texture!

I cut the wreath and all the sentiments at once from the Effortless Artistry Paper using the Coordinating die. It’s such a time saver!

I used a portion of the wreath on the bottom left and top right of the card panel. It’s a great way to create a different look!

I chose the sentiment “Warm Wishes” because it sure is warm here today (111 degrees!) and I thought it was appropriate. Lol. I finished off the card with the beautiful Fern Dew Drops.
